Cocktail celebration 

Make your online cocktail party and invite your friends to attend. Think about anything that could make the event you’re arranging more memorable. Choose a theme for your cocktail hour, for example, so that the mood is already set before your guests arrive. It might be based on a significant decade, complete with attire and music from that period.

The 1920s could produce a glamorous effect, whereas the 1970s provided a disco setting as well as the fashion that followed. A personalized cocktail menu is another excellent approach to elevate your online party and impress your attendees. You can attempt preparing a new drink together, or you can send each other recipes to try. First and foremost, don’t be concerned if some of the cocktails you try do not work out. You are expected to enjoy yourself and make the most of your time together. 

Kitchen instruction 

Because of the epidemic, many of you are undoubtedly missing the Sunday dinners you used to have with your families, where you could catch up on each other’s lives and spend quality time together. Your family and relatives include senior members who, given the current health dangers, should take particular care of themselves and minimize their interaction with others as much as possible.

As a solution to the problem of distance, your grandma or aunt, who is famous in the family for the delicious comfort food that they provide, can volunteer to teach you how to cook. Make sure everyone is on the same page by discussing what supplies they will require well in advance of the meal. Also, practice patience. Because elderly members of your family may struggle to understand modern technology, you should take the time to clearly explain how to use it.

Karaoke on the internet 

Do you miss the karaoke nights before the pandemic, when you could vent your frustrations by belting out your favorite rock and R&B tunes from the 1980s and 2000s? We don’t have the luxury of time. Gather your fellow karaoke aficionados and hold a music session over the weekend. You can either choose a song for your friend to sing or an era of music that you enjoy. Naturally, you shouldn’t take this as a talent show (unless you want to), but rather as a fun way to spend time with the people you care about. 

The Book Club meets

Characters who read a lot are rarely lonely because they are always engrossed in stories about made-up people who have interesting lives. Those of you who enjoy reading may feel compelled to share your opinions with others, but you should also strive to see things from other people’s perspectives.

Historically, book clubs met either in people’s homes or in public libraries. However, one should not let their current circumstances prohibit them from appreciating a fantastic book. Make plans with other readers to participate in an online book club and discuss the most recent book you read.
